The size of Mount Pleasant is approximately 2.2 square kilometres. It has 5 parks covering nearly 7.7% of total area. The population of Mount Pleasant in 2016 was 2203 people. By 2021 the population was 2225 showing a population growth of 1.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Mount Pleasant is 20-29 years. Households in Mount Pleasant are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Mount Pleasant work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 56.80% of the homes in Mount Pleasant were owner-occupied compared with 59.20% in 2016.
